From 979b18653f078353c777173a76712fbc3436a510 Mon Sep 17 00:00:00 2001 From: chen-xin-zhi <3588068430@qq.com> Date: Thu, 5 Jun 2025 21:26:58 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E5=A4=8D=E4=BA=86=E5=AF=86=E7=A0=81?= =?UTF-8?q?=E9=87=8D=E7=BD=AE=E7=9A=84=E6=8E=A5=E5=8F=A3?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../promotion/service/userInfo/UserInfoService.java | 2 +- .../service/userInfo/impl/UserInfoServiceImpl.java | 9 +-------- 2 files changed, 2 insertions(+), 9 deletions(-) diff --git a/src/main/java/com/greenorange/promotion/service/userInfo/UserInfoService.java b/src/main/java/com/greenorange/promotion/service/userInfo/UserInfoService.java index e2242fb..79b637d 100644 --- a/src/main/java/com/greenorange/promotion/service/userInfo/UserInfoService.java +++ b/src/main/java/com/greenorange/promotion/service/userInfo/UserInfoService.java @@ -49,7 +49,7 @@ public interface UserInfoService extends IService { /** * 小程序用户重置密码 */ - String userInfoMiniResetPwd(UserInfoResetRequest userInfoResetRequest, boolean isInner); + void userInfoMiniResetPwd(UserInfoResetRequest userInfoResetRequest, boolean isInner); /** diff --git a/src/main/java/com/greenorange/promotion/service/userInfo/impl/UserInfoServiceImpl.java b/src/main/java/com/greenorange/promotion/service/userInfo/impl/UserInfoServiceImpl.java index 9d154ef..a6a6450 100644 --- a/src/main/java/com/greenorange/promotion/service/userInfo/impl/UserInfoServiceImpl.java +++ b/src/main/java/com/greenorange/promotion/service/userInfo/impl/UserInfoServiceImpl.java @@ -280,7 +280,7 @@ public class UserInfoServiceImpl extends ServiceImpl * 小程序用户重置密码 */ @Override - public String userInfoMiniResetPwd(UserInfoResetRequest userInfoResetRequest, boolean isInner) { + public void userInfoMiniResetPwd(UserInfoResetRequest userInfoResetRequest, boolean isInner) { String phoneNumber = userInfoResetRequest.getPhoneNumber(); ThrowUtils.throwIf(RegexUtils.isPhoneInvalid(phoneNumber), ErrorCode.PARAMS_ERROR, "手机号格式无效"); @@ -300,12 +300,7 @@ public class UserInfoServiceImpl extends ServiceImpl lambdaUpdateWrapper.eq(UserInfo::getPhoneNumber, phoneNumber).set(UserInfo::getUserPassword, userPassword); this.update(lambdaUpdateWrapper); - String token = "密码重置成功"; if (isInner) { - Map payload = new HashMap<>(); - payload.put("userAccount", phoneNumber); - payload.put("userPassword", userPassword); - token = jwtUtils.generateToken(payload); // 获取token的过期时间 String sourceToken = userInfoResetRequest.getSourceToken(); DecodedJWT decodedJWT = jwtUtils.verify(sourceToken); @@ -313,8 +308,6 @@ public class UserInfoServiceImpl extends ServiceImpl // 将token存入Redis黑名单,并设置过期时间与token一致 redisTemplate.opsForValue().set(sourceToken, sourceToken, expirationTime, TimeUnit.MILLISECONDS); } - // 更新token - return token; }